Dahlias bloom all summer right on til frost in a dazzling array of colors, flower forms and sizes. The key to success when growing dahlias, and filling your garden with these gorgeous blooms is all in the details. Your Dahlia Planting Infographic Guide: 1 - Choose great quality dahlia tubers, whether dwarf or dinner plate dahlias, or any variety and size in between. 2 - Leave your dahlia tubers intact - do not cut dahlia tubers apart or into pieces. 3 - Plant your dahlia tubers in full sun, about 3-4 inches deep, and 12-24"
